bronze, A. 7.5 x 11 x 2.5; B. 11 x 10 x 3, A. signed on the base, "AP"; B. signed on the base, "AP"

Asen Peykov is a great sculptor who worked from the 1920s to the 1960s. Most of his life was spent in the eternal city of Rome. There he developed his talent and ideas, and left a rich legacy not only of his sculptural works and his collection of paintings, but also the memory of a creator who inspired many people. The period of the 1960s was a turning point in Peikov's life. It is from that time that his most famous and perhaps his biggest project dates - the sculpture of Leonardo da Vinci, which greets arrivals at Rome's Fuimcino airport. And at the end of the decade, Asen Peykov returned to Bulgaria (for the first time in 31 years), when a competition for a monument to Khan Asparuh was announced. The sculptor begins work on the assigned subject. He created the project "The Heroic Cavalry of Khan Asparukh", which is a multi-figure composition with horsemen led by Khan Asparukh. The work was not realized and Peykov received only an incentive award from the Bulgarian jury. Based on this information, we can assume that the two small sculptures presented in the lot with the title "Allure" are highly likely to have been part of the corresponding project of Asen Peykov.
